You might not think that a player with a name like Lars Nootbar would be representing Team Japan at the World Baseball Classic.Although he was born in California, he claims Japanese links through his mother, who was born on the Asian Isle.Entering the tournament, South Korea were seen as Team Japan's biggest challenger in their group. However, the KBO-stacked team dropped their first game of the World Baseball Classic in an 8-7 upset against Australia.During the top 5th inning of today's game against South Korea at Tokyo Dome, Nootbar made a scintilating catch. This came on a tailing fly-ball that came off the bat of San Diego Padres shortstop Ha-seong Kim. The play kept Japan ahead by a 4-3 margin.
